Автор Тема: Ошибка при установке Альт Образование 8.2 х64 на новый компьютер  (Прочитано 20212 раз)

Оффлайн OlegBB

  • Давно тут
  • **
  • Сообщений: 95
Добрый день!
Нам поставили моноблоки AIO iRU Office H2123 21,5" Full HD Ryzen 3 2200G/8GB/1TB 7.2K/Vega/DVDRW/CR/DOS/WiFi+BT/KB/M/BLACK 1920*1080 для учебного класса. Не пытайтесь искать эту модель на сайте производителя (это ультра-новая модель, ее там еще нет).
В биосе для SATA Mode есть только 2 опции: AHCI и RAID (не наш случай).
Пробую ставить Альт Образование 8.2 х64 через UEFI и без него. Результат один: на этапе 6/12 (Сохранение настроек) - Запуск скрипта 50-initrd.sh не удался. Потом идут остальные этапы. Но после перезагрузки 4 пингвина и сообщения об ошибке (пытаюсь вставить скриншот...).

На сайте производителя материнской платы никакой линукс не указан https://www.gigabyte.com/Motherboard/GA-A320M-S2H-rev-1x#support-dl-utility.

LiveCD-версии не грузятся вообще. При этом весь экран в размазанных точках-тире... Нечитабельный. При загрузке среди этой "мазни" можно рассмотреть бегущую полоску, а потом меняющиеся строчки и остановка (причем на Alt+F12 тоже "мазня").

Есть только одна ложка меда:
мне удалось поставить Альт Рабочая станция 8.2 х64. При загрузке в размазанных разноцветных точках-тире проглядывало меню выбора источника установки и имени образа. Я угадал с нажатиями в этом меню и загрузка пошла... и пошла... и пошла до финиша без проблем в нормальном графическом режиме. И потом грузилась Альт Рабочая станция и работает нормально.
Это показывает, что совместимость с продуктами Альт все-таки есть.

Каким образом обойти эту проблему (50-initrd.sh) в Альт Образование?

P.S. О проблемах со скриптом 50-initrd.sh на форуме есть несколько старых сообщений. Прошу помочь именно с Образованием 8.2.

Оффлайн berkut_174

  • Мастер
  • ***
  • Сообщений: 6 994
    • Email
LiveCD-версии не грузятся вообще.
Регулярные сборки ?
Сноси Винду, переходи на Линукс ! :)

Оффлайн berkut_174

  • Мастер
  • ***
  • Сообщений: 6 994
    • Email
Насчёт разноцветных точек-тире, попробуйте запустить установку с параметрами xdriver=vesa nomodeset.
Сноси Винду, переходи на Линукс ! :)

Оффлайн OlegBB

  • Давно тут
  • **
  • Сообщений: 95
Сборки регулярные. Отсюда https://mirror.yandex.ru/altlinux/p8/images/education/

С параметром "xdriver=vesa nomodeset" загрузилось LiveCD. Мазни при загрузке нет.
Спасибо!

Проблема с 50-initrd.sh не ушла.

Оффлайн berkut_174

  • Мастер
  • ***
  • Сообщений: 6 994
    • Email
Приведите прямые ссылки на проблемный образ дистрибутива и тот, который удалось установить.

Целостность записанного образа, я так понимаю, проверяли ?
Сноси Винду, переходи на Линукс ! :)

Оффлайн OlegBB

  • Давно тут
  • **
  • Сообщений: 95
Приведите прямые ссылки на проблемный образ дистрибутива и тот, который удалось установить.

Установил:
https://mirror.yandex.ru/altlinux/p8/images/kworkstation/alt-kworkstation-8.2-install-x86_64.iso

Не ставится:
https://mirror.yandex.ru/altlinux/p8/images/education/alt-education-8.2-x86_64.iso

Контрольные суммы скачанного образа проверил. С этой же флешки несколько Альт Образование успешно поставил несколько дней назад.
« Последнее редактирование: 25.07.2018 13:09:05 от OlegBB »

Оффлайн berkut_174

  • Мастер
  • ***
  • Сообщений: 6 994
    • Email
Значит, получается, что с более новым ядром проблемы...

Тогда, если предположить, что все дальнейшие шаги прошли без проблем и всё нормально установилось, кроме сборки initrd, то можно попробовать зачрутиться в установленную систему и собрать initrd вручную. Вдруг что-то прояснится при этом. Также можно там же, в чруте, выполнить dist-upgrade и даже обновить ядро.
Сноси Винду, переходи на Линукс ! :)

Оффлайн Speccyfighter

  • Мастер
  • ***
  • Сообщений: 9 578
Очень ИМХО:

Для этого железа, p8/branch безнадёжно устарел.
Можно почитать ветку:
https://forum.manjaro.org/t/i-cant-find-a-graphics-driver-for-amd-ryzen-5-with-vega-rx-8/40338/37

В этом блоке, процессор Ryzen 3 2200G со встроенной  AMD Radeon RX Vega 8
В сизифе есть 4.17.9-un-def и 18-я mesa
И свежий драйвер:
$ rpm -qpivl ./xorg-drv-amdgpu-18.0.1-alt1.i586.rpm
Name        : xorg-drv-amdgpu              Relocations: (not relocatable)
Version     : 18.0.1                            Vendor: ALT Linux Team
Release     : alt1                          Build Date: Чт 31 май 2018 11:07:13
Install date: (not installed)               Build Host: shrek-sisyphus.hasher.altlinux.org
Group       : Система/X11            Source RPM: xorg-drv-amdgpu-18.0.1-alt1.src.rpm
Size        : 156460                           License: MIT/X11
Packager    : shrek@altlinux.ru (Valery Inozemtsev) <shrek@altlinux.org>
URL         : http://cgit.freedesktop.org/xorg/driver/xf86-video-amdgpu
Summary     : AMD GPU video driver for the Xorg X server
Description :
AMD GPU video driver for the Xorg X server
drwxr-xr-x    2 root    root                0 май 28 15:41 /usr/lib/X11/modules/drivers
-rw-r--r--    1 root    root           154492 май 28 15:41 /usr/lib/X11/modules/drivers/amdgpu_drv.so
-rw-r--r--    1 root    root               92 май 28 15:41 /usr/share/X11/xorg.conf.d/10-amdgpu.conf
-rw-r--r--    1 root    root             1876 май 28 15:41 /usr/share/man/man4/amdgpu.4.xz

Если мне не изменяет память, то регуляный xfce из ночных сборок (не sysv-xfce) идёт с un-def ядром, а текущее в сизифе - 4.17. Этот образ лайв. Можно на пробу его грузануть с флешки.
« Последнее редактирование: 25.07.2018 17:33:45 от Speccyfighter »

Оффлайн OlegBB

  • Давно тут
  • **
  • Сообщений: 95
Сегодня еще раз скачал образ, проверил контрольную сумму, записал на новую флешку и попробовал установить Альт Образование.
Результат тот же.
Пробую разные варианты, но пока безуспешно.
Может подождать какую-нибудь версию 8.3... Вдруг там включат поддержку "моего" оборудования?


Еще раз установил Альт Рабочая станция - установка прошла успешно. Хотя, при работе выявил неприятную особенность - нет возможности работать без графики. Во всех "не графических режимах" на экране точки-тире (короче мазня):
1. При включении или выключении
2. На всех экранах Alt+F2, Alt+F12 и т.д.

Где нужно прописать параметры (типа "xdriver=vesa nomodeset"), чтобы сразу эту проблему решить?
« Последнее редактирование: 27.07.2018 14:49:07 от OlegBB »

Оффлайн yaleks

  • Мастер
  • ***
  • Сообщений: 5 758
Может подождать какую-нибудь версию 8.3... Вдруг там включат поддержку "моего" оборудования?
нормальной поддержки в p8 не ждите, да и не факт что в p9 будет...

Оффлайн NickM

  • Давно тут
  • **
  • Сообщений: 426
    • Email
Значит, получается, что с более новым ядром проблемы...

Тогда, если предположить, что все дальнейшие шаги прошли без проблем и всё нормально установилось, кроме сборки initrd, то можно попробовать зачрутиться в установленную систему и собрать initrd вручную. Вдруг что-то прояснится при этом. Также можно там же, в чруте, выполнить dist-upgrade и даже обновить ядро.

Вполне рабочий вариант по выходу из сложившейся ситуации, если действительно только initrd не собрался.

Читаем в статье "Восстановление загрузочной записи" раздел "Если нужны изменения в initrd"

Ну и сюда заглянуть можно на всякий случай...

Оффлайн Speccyfighter

  • Мастер
  • ***
  • Сообщений: 9 578
Пробую разные варианты, но пока безуспешно.
Может подождать какую-нибудь версию 8.3... Вдруг там включат поддержку "моего" оборудования?

Где нужно прописать параметры (типа "xdriver=vesa nomodeset"), чтобы сразу эту проблему решить?

Вы так и не поняли.
- Никакого 8.3 с "включенной поддержкой" не будет. Будет 9.0, но не завтра и не послезавтра.
- Есть связка: ядро - ядерный модуль - Xorg драйвер - mesa. Ядерный модуль может быть новее чем X-драйвер, но не наоборот.
- В нормально работающей системе у вас должен подниматься amdgpu драйвер, а не этот костыль через vesa с nomodeset. В текущем Линукс под ваш GPU нет подходящего драйвера. И не будет. Единственный шанс, это смотреть в Сизиф, репозиторий комьюнити. Всё как в винде: есть подходящий драйвер, - есть поддержка видео; нет драйвера - нет видео, или только через vesa. Грубо говоря, у вас сейчас не Линукс, а Винда без видеодрайвера.

Даже не пытайтесь использовать этот образ
http://nightly.altlinux.org/sisyphus/current/regular-xfce-latest-x86_64.iso
http://nightly.altlinux.org/sisyphus/current/regular-xfce-latest-i586.iso

Здесь есть любой пакет, но не тот который вам нужен:
# mount /home/user/hlam/xfce-s-d/regular-xfce-latest-i586.iso /mnt/disk1 -o loop
mount: /mnt/disk1: WARNING: device write-protected, mounted read-only.
# mount /mnt/disk1/live /mnt/disk2/ -o loop
# chroot /mnt/disk2
# rpm -qa | grep 'kernel-image\|amdgpu'
kernel-image-un-def-4.17.9-alt1.i586
# rpm -qa | grep 'xorg-drv-amdgpu'
[root@comp /]#
# rpm -qa | grep 'xorg-drv-'
xorg-drv-qxl-0.1.4-alt6.i586
xorg-drv-fbdev-0.5.0-alt1.i586
xorg-drv-vboxvideo-1.0.0-alt1.i586
xorg-drv-nouveau-1.0.15-alt1.i586
xorg-drv-r128-6.10.2-alt1.i586
xorg-drv-cirrus-1.5.3-alt3.i586
xorg-drv-libinput-0.28.0-alt1.i586
xorg-drv-vesa-2.4.0-alt1.i586
xorg-drv-mach64-6.9.6-alt1.i586
xorg-drv-vmmouse-13.1.0-alt3.i586
xorg-drv-wacom-0.33.0-alt1.i586
xorg-drv-evdev-2.10.4-alt2.i586
xorg-drv-radeon-18.0.1-alt1.i586
xorg-drv-ati-18.0.1-alt1.i586
xorg-drv-vmware-13.3.0-alt1.i586
xorg-drv-synaptics-1.9.0-alt1.i586
xorg-drv-intel-2.99.917-alt7.i586
xorg-drv-wizardpen-0.8.1-alt2.i586
# rpm -qa | grep 'xorg-dri-'
xorg-dri-swrast-18.1.3-alt1.S1.i586
xorg-dri-nouveau-18.1.3-alt1.S1.i586
xorg-dri-radeon-18.1.3-alt1.S1.i586
xorg-dri-intel-18.1.3-alt1.S1.i586
# find / -name "*lib/4*" -o -name "*amdgpu*" 2>/dev/null
/lib/firmware/LICENSE.amdgpu
/lib/firmware/amdgpu
/lib/modules/4.17.9-un-def-alt1/kernel/drivers/gpu/drm/amd/amdgpu
/lib/modules/4.17.9-un-def-alt1/kernel/drivers/gpu/drm/amd/amdgpu/amdgpu.ko.gz
/usr/lib/libdrm_amdgpu.so.1
/usr/lib/libdrm_amdgpu.so.1.0.0
/usr/share/doc/firmware-linux-20180710/LICENSE.amdgpu
/usr/share/libdrm/amdgpu.ids
# rpm -qf /usr/lib/libdrm_amdgpu.so.1
libdrm-2.4.92-alt1.S1.i586

Оффлайн Speccyfighter

  • Мастер
  • ***
  • Сообщений: 9 578
Альт Образование.
Результат тот же.
Пробую разные варианты, но пока безуспешно.

Вы это прочитали?
Можно почитать ветку:
https://forum.manjaro.org/t/i-cant-find-a-graphics-driver-for-amd-ryzen-5-with-vega-rx-8/40338/37

Особенно последнее сообщение
https://forum.manjaro.org/t/i-cant-find-a-graphics-driver-for-amd-ryzen-5-with-vega-rx-8/40338/38

У парня Vega 11, у вас Vega 8, но принципиальной разницы нет.
И парень там сказал, что то что он получил, было фантастикой.

Оффлайн OlegBB

  • Давно тут
  • **
  • Сообщений: 95
Все это время пытался "решить" проблему с Альт-Образование 8.2:
1. восстанавливал GRUB (не помогло)
2. восстанавливал initrd (не помогло)
3. обновлялся до сизифа (после обновления - не грузится)
4. даже попытался ставить manjaro (не установилась)
и т.д

В большинстве неудачных стартов системы - ошибка в SDDM (зацикливается при его загрузке).

Обнаружил, что в установленной с ошибкой в скрипте 50-initrd.sh системе директории /proc и /dev пустые (заметил при монтировании раздела в CD-LIVE).

Возможно, скрипт 50-initrd.sh на это и ругался...

Натолкнула на мысль цитата:

Значит, получается, что с более новым ядром проблемы...

Решил попробовать установить Альт-Образование 8.0, и... мысль оказалась верной. Система устанавливается и обновляется до 8.2.
Проблема с графическим драйвером не решена - можно работать только в графике.

Пока останавливаюсь на этом (временном) варианте.
Студенты учатся только в графическом режиме (юристы).
Буду ждать обновления ядра до 4.15+, чтобы продолжить эксперименты с видео-драйверами.


P.S. Для эксперимента на рабочей системе Альт-Образование обновился до сизифа, но ядро там меньше 4.15.
« Последнее редактирование: 15.08.2018 06:18:16 от OlegBB »

Оффлайн Skull

  • Глобальный модератор
  • *****
  • Сообщений: 18 551
    • Домашняя страница
    • Email
Андрей Черепанов (cas@)